How do you write a concert review?

The main body of your concert review should incorporate a description of different compositions played during the musical event. Elaborate your notes on the musical performances. It is better to discuss each performance in a separate paragraph. Your description format may vary according to the music genres.

What defines music?

Music, art concerned with combining vocal or instrumental sounds for beauty of form or emotional expression, usually according to cultural standards of rhythm, melody, and, in most Western music, harmony. Both the simple folk song and the complex electronic composition belong to the same activity, music.

What makes a good album review?

Listen to the album at least 5 times. It is easy to tell when a reviewer has only listened to something once, and it never makes for a good review. 7 to 10 listens is ideal. Jot down notes when you notice something. A review should have evidence.

How do you critique a band performance?

Include the title, date, time and location of the performance. Also include information about the particular group or artist you are critiquing as well as general impressions of the performance. State the title and composer of the piece you are critiquing.

How do you critique a singer?

Provide an analysis of the clarity of the singer’s words. This is called diction, and is an important aspect of singing. If the singer does not articulate words clearly, you must discuss this with her so she can improve her voice. Evaluate the singer’s ability to emphasize the beginning and ending of phrases….

What is evaluative essay?

An evaluation essay is a composition that offers value judgments about a particular subject according to a set of criteria. Also called evaluative writing, evaluative essay or report, and critical evaluation essay. “Any kind of review is essentially a piece of evaluative writing,” says Allen S….

What is a Evaluation paragraph?

Evaluation Paragraphs In an evaluation paragraph, you make judgments about people, ideas, and possible actions. You need to make your evaluation based on certain criteria that you develop. In the paragraph, you will state your evaluation or recommendation and then support it by referring to your criteria.
